The adverse effects of over-fertilizing plants are one of the most common problems in plant care, which can easily disrupt the health of roots, leaves, and even flowering. Contrary to the common belief that “the more fertilizer, the better growth,” the reality is that excessive feeding not only provides no benefit but can also lead to salt accumulation in the soil, toxicity in the root environment, and reduced plant resistance to pests and diseases.

Symptoms of incorrect or excessive use of chemical fertilizers
If you observe the following symptoms in your plants, it is likely that improper or excessive fertilization is the cause of these issues:
-
White layer on the soil surface: Salt residues from excessive fertilizer use appear as white deposits on the soil surface.
-
Leaf tip burn: The appearance of brown coloration at the tips or edges of leaves is one of the clear signs of soil salinity or overfeeding.
-
Yellowing and curling of leaves: Plants under stress from incorrect fertilization often show yellow, wilted, or curled leaves.
-
Deformed and abnormal leaves: Changes in leaf shape may indicate an imbalance in nutrient elements.
-
Leaf, flower, or fruit drop: This may be a direct result of root damage or excessive uptake of certain nutrients.
-
Root rot: Roots that turn brown or black and become soft or decayed are usually damaged due to salinity or excessive salt accumulation.
-
Poor growth despite proper care: If the plant does not grow despite adequate watering and sufficient light, the problem is likely due to incorrect fertilization.
-
Abnormal stem growth: Excessive, elongated, and thin stems indicate nutrient imbalance.
-
Reduced flowering: Plants that receive excessive fertilizer usually allocate their energy to vegetative growth, resulting in poor flowering.
To prevent nutritional problems, fertilization should be carried out based on the actual needs of the plant, soil type, and the level of nutrients present in it. Using standard fertilizers with balanced formulations, along with soil testing before fertilization, helps determine the exact required amount. Also, proper dosage and correct timing play an important role in maintaining plant health and vitality.

Why is excessive fertilizer use dangerous for plants?
Incorrect or excessive use of fertilizers is one of the most common causes of problems in houseplants and landscape plants. Contrary to the common belief that “more fertilizer means better growth,” overfeeding can damage plant health.
In fact, three major negative effects occur due to excessive fertilization:
-
Roots are unable to properly absorb water.
-
The soil becomes toxic.
-
Plant susceptibility to diseases and pests increases.
Salts present in chemical fertilizers can prevent water absorption by roots. As a result, the plant suffers from dehydration, which usually first appears in the leaves.
In addition, excessive accumulation of nutrients can disrupt the activity of essential plant enzymes and interfere with its natural biological processes. A plant under nutritional stress is more vulnerable to pest and disease attacks.
Common causes of excessive fertilizer use
-
Gradual accumulation of leftover fertilizers from previous feedings
-
Unintentional overuse of slow-release fertilizers beyond required amounts
-
Poor soil drainage preventing salt leaching
-
Improper feeding conditions such as extreme dryness or plant dormancy
-
Continuing fertilization even after plant growth has stopped

Review of symptoms of over-fertilization in plants
Depending on the plant type and environmental conditions, the following symptoms may appear. Note that some signs are similar to other problems such as underwatering, low light, or pests; therefore, a complete assessment of plant conditions is essential.
1. White or yellow layer on soil surface
The formation of salt deposits is a clear sign of overfeeding. If left untreated, these salts can make the soil toxic. Removing the surface layer and thoroughly watering the soil can help flush it out. If drainage is poor, replacing the soil or pot is recommended.
2. Leaf tip and edge burn
Brown coloration on leaf edges, especially in long leaves, is an early sign of excessive fertilizer use. This damage is not easily reversible, but soil flushing can prevent further harm.
3. Yellowing or wilting leaves
Loss of moisture due to salt accumulation can cause lower leaves to turn yellow or the entire plant to wilt. First confirm that fertilizer is the cause, then flush the soil.

4. Deformed or curled leaves
Excess nitrogen or nutrient imbalance can cause leaf deformation; therefore, curled leaves are one of the symptoms of over-fertilized plants. If detected early, reducing fertilizer and flushing the soil may save the plant.
5. Dark and rotting roots
Root rot is one of the most severe consequences of over-fertilization. To check, remove the plant from the pot and inspect the roots. Black, soft, and foul-smelling roots indicate rot. In this case, removing infected roots and disinfecting the soil with hydrogen peroxide is recommended.

6. Leaf, flower, or fruit drop
Excessive feeding can cause shock and shedding of plant organs, especially if the plant is recovering from previous stress. In this case, stop fertilization and flush the soil.
7. Growth stagnation or slowdown
If a plant does not grow despite proper conditions, one possible reason is excessive fertilizer use. After checking other factors (light, temperature, watering), reduce or temporarily stop fertilization.
8. Weak, spindly growth
Excess nitrogen can cause plants to produce thin and weak stems, which are more vulnerable to damage and pests. Reducing fertilizer, providing adequate light, and pruning damaged shoots can restore balanced growth.
9. Reduced flowering or fruiting
Plants receiving excessive nitrogen allocate most of their energy to leaf and stem growth and fail to flower. In such cases, nutrient balance should be adjusted and flowering-specific fertilizers should be used.
Final solution to prevent the side effects of over-fertilization
If you are unsure whether your plant’s problem is due to excessive fertilizer use, flush the soil, temporarily stop fertilization, and allow the plant to recover under new conditions. To prevent such issues:
-
Use high-quality fertilizers with balanced formulations.
-
Always follow the application instructions precisely.
-
Check the plant’s status after each fertilization.
Note: Less fertilizer is always better than too much!
